About Waltraud A. Arts at a glance

Waltraud A. Arts is a Member based in Madison, Wisconsin, practicing at Waltraud A. Arts. They have 47+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1979. Their practice focuses on business and zoning. Admitted to practice in Wisconsin (1979), U.S. District Court, Western District of Wisconsin (1979), U.S. District Court, Eastern District of Wisconsin (1980), and U.S. Court of Appeals, Seventh Circuit (1991). Educated at University of Wisconsin (J.D., 1979) and Mount Senario College (B.A., 1972). Recognitions include AV Preeminent. Active member of Dane County Bar Association State Bar of Wisconsin. Why local counsel matters in Wisconsin

Practicing law in Wisconsin. Legal matters in Wisconsin are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Madison are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Wisconsin state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Wisconsin br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Wisconsin cour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
